Getting There

  • Auto-Rickshaw

    From the Varanasi city center, find an auto-rickshaw stand. Negotiate the fare to Sarnath, which is approximately 10 km away. The driver will take you to Sarnath - Munari Rd. Once you reach the Sarnath area, ask the driver to drop you near the Wat Thai Varanasi Buddha Vipassana Temple, located at 92JC+97M, Sarnath - Munari Rd. It's a well-known location, so most drivers will be familiar with it.

  • Cycle Rickshaw

    If you are near the Sarnath area, you can hire a cycle rickshaw to the Wat Thai Varanasi Buddha Vipassana Temple. Tell the rickshaw puller the destination address: 92JC+97M, Sarnath - Munari Rd. The distance is about 3 km, and the ride will take approximately 10-15 minutes.

  • Walking

    If you are already in the Sarnath area, you can walk to the Wat Thai Varanasi Buddha Vipassana Temple. Start from the Sarnath archaeological site and head northwest towards Sarnath - Munari Rd. Walk along this road for about 1.5 km, and you will reach the temple. It should take you around 20-25 minutes on foot.

Discover more about Wat Thai Varanasi buddha vipassana (วัดไทยพาราณสี พุทธวิปัสสนา)

Wat Thai Varanasi, a serene Buddhist temple located in the historic area of Sarnath, is a sanctuary for those seeking spiritual enlightenment and tranquility. Known for its exquisite architecture and lush gardens, this temple serves as an important pilgrimage site for Buddhists from around the world. The temple is adorned with intricate carvings and statues that depict various scenes from the life of Buddha, allowing visitors to engage with the rich history and teachings of Buddhism. The peaceful ambiance makes it an ideal location for meditation, reflection, or simply to enjoy the beauty of the surroundings. As you stroll through the grounds, take a moment to appreciate the serene atmosphere and the sound of nature, which creates a calming backdrop for your visit. The temple is particularly breathtaking during the early morning hours when the soft light illuminates the intricate details of the architecture. Visitors often find themselves drawn to the meditation area, where they can participate in mindfulness practices or simply sit in silence to absorb the peaceful energy that permeates the space. Wat Thai Varanasi also offers opportunities to learn about Buddhist philosophy and participate in various spiritual activities. Be sure to check the temple’s schedule, as certain days may feature special ceremonies or teachings that provide deeper insights into the practice of Buddhism.
